If youve taken that much off without knowing if its ever be done before it would pay to put them on without the head gasket and turn the engine over by hand and check nothing is touching , if all good proceed.
If you've scrapped away to remove crud in your cooling system, you might want to consider using something to catch it moving around now. Not sure of what you guys have in the U.S. but here I run cone filters in the top hoses of the radiator.
